iOS应用签名是指在Apple官方证书下对应用进行数字签名,确保应用来源的合法性以及完整性。IOS签名可以分为正式签名和企业签名。正式签名是指苹果官方证书对应用进行签名,使之可以在App Store上线销售;企业签名则是以企业开发者账号进行签名,仅限内部分发并无法在App Store上架。iOS应用签名还能实现对应用的二次打包、自定义开发、加壳保护等功能。
苹果签名保证了应用的来源和完整性,防止第三方意图修改或植入恶意代码苹果企业购买流程图。签名还能够保证应用在传输和存储过程中的安全性,为苹果设备提供更加安全的环境。同时,苹果签名也有助于应用的推广和营销,用户可以通过信任苹果签名来获得更多安全优质的应用选择。
iOS应用签名的实现方式主要分为以下两种:
正式签名:使用苹果官方证书进行签名,可以使应用上架App Store进行全球范围内的销售和推广。
企业签名:使用企业开发者账号进行签名,用于内部分发应用,只在企业内部使用,不可上架App Store。
iOS签名的步骤主要分为以下几个环节:
应用准备:将需要签名的应用准备好,包括源码、资源文件、证书等信息。
生成证书:到苹果开发者中心创建证书,包括开发证书,描述文件等。
绑定证书:将证书绑定到应用中,使用Xcode工具进行处理。
测试签名:将应用签名后在测试设备上进行测试,查看是否签名成功和应用的正常性。
申请正式签名:当所有测试完毕,具备上架条件时,在苹果开发者中心申请正式签名。
上架和分发:获取签名后的应用可以通过App Store进行销售,或进行企业分发。
企业签名实现的关键在于拥有合法的企业开发者账号,只有过审后才能申请开通企业签名权限。企业签名的具体步骤可参考“iOS签名的步骤”,将其适当调整为企业内部流程即可。需要注意的是,企业签名的应用只能在企业内部使用,无法在App Store上架、分发或销售。
iOS应用签名是iOS开发过程中不可忽视的一环,既有利于开发者开发ios证书在哪个文件夹打开好???推广应用,也是用户安全选择的重要保障苹果企业开发者账号特点及价格是多少?。开发者应该遵循苹果的签名规范和流程,保证应用的安全和合法性,同时,苹果也应该加强验证机制,确保签名的有效性和可靠性。
近年来,iOS开发者在发布应用程序时必须获取有效的签名证书。在选择签名证书时,开发者常会面临一个选择:个人版签名证书还是企业版签名证书?本文将详细介绍iOS签名证书个人版与企业版的区别,帮助开发者...
iOS签名:让你的iPhone/iPad充满活力 iOS签名是一个允许用户在其iOS设备上安装第三方应用程序的方法苹果微信怎么使用企业号。通过有效的iOS签名,你可以下载并运行各种应用程序和游戏,而...
探讨ios签名后闪退问题的原因及解决办法 ios签名后闪退是很多开发者在应用程序开发过程中常常遇到的问题之一。无论是在测试阶段还是发布上线后,闪退都会严重影响用户体验和应用程序的稳定性。本文将从多...
iOS签名工具大全,轻松解锁苹果设备 苹果签名是iOS设备系统更新或者越狱的前提条件之一,但苹果公司限制了非官方签名的软件和应用的安装,所以要通过其他途径进行签名,以便在iOS设备上安装软件和应用。...
签名的重要性苹果自签软件源 在现代技术时代,签名是一种重要的方式,用于验证和确认电子信息的来源和真实性。针对苹果公司来说,签名不仅仅是一种身份验证工具,还可以用于分发信息给客服。通过合理的签名策略...
为什么iOS企业签名会导致闪退 iOS企业签名是一种通过企业证书和描述文件来授权企业应用在iOS设备上安装和运行的方式。但是,有时候在使用企业签名进行应用分发时,会遇到闪退的问题。这种问题的出现通...